Kimchi Project: 2.5 kN LOX/Ethanol Lander Program
Flagship pressure-fed lander effort centered on a throttleable 2.5 kN-class LOX/Ethanol engine and vertical-landing trajectory.
2025 - OngoingLOX/Ethanol2.5 kNLanderThrottleable Engine

Role
Propulsion development and system-level integration planning
Challenge
Connect ambitious mission targets with realistic student-team build limits while preserving testability and safety margins.
Approach
Used project presentation material to define mass budget, feed architecture, throttle envelope, and phased test milestones.
Result
Established a coherent propulsion direction with clear system targets and an executable path toward landing-oriented test gates.
Progression Context
Represents a shift from early engine builds into a larger mission-framed propulsion program.
Key Technical Markers
- Nominal thrust target: 2.5 kN
- Pressure-fed LOX/Ethanol baseline
- Throttle target down to 40% (program goal)
- Lander constraints mapped to test sequence requirements
